2002-09-13  Tor Lillqvist  <tml@iki.fi>

	* Makefile.am (USE_INSTALLED_GLIB): Seems that the automake
	version used by Havoc doesn't recognize pkg_config_CFLAGS and
	pkg_config_LDFLAGS, thus failing builds on Win32 directly from the
	tarball. Set included_glib_includes and pkg_config_LDADD instead,
	then, like in the !USE_INSTALLED_GLIB branch.

	* findme.c (X_OK): If X_OK undefined, define as 1, always, not
	only if G_OS_WIN32, which is never defined here. Fixes a corner
	case on Win32 with MSYS and mingw where configure as included in
	the release tarball for some reason doesn't find unistd.h.

2001-10-27  Tor Lillqvist  <tml@iki.fi>

	New Win32 feature to make pkg-config useful for users of MSVC:
	with the flag --msvc-syntax, munge -L and -l flags appropriately
	for the MSVC command-line compiler. (-I flags are the same.)

	* README.win32: Update.

	* main.c (main): Add --msvc-syntax flag.

	* pkg-config.1: Document it.

	* pkg.h: Declare msvc_syntax.

	* parse.c (parse_libs): Obey msvc_syntax.

2001-09-30  Tor Lillqvist  <tml@iki.fi>

	Changes for "pure" Win32 (without Cygwin or similar)
	support. The most important differences compared to pkg-config
	on Unix are:

	We don't use hardcoded PKGLIBDIR paths but deduce the
	installation prefix at runtime.

	Use the normal GLib DLL, not a private copy. Yes, this does
	introduce a circular dependency, but that can be worked around.

	* README.win32: New file.

	* configure.in: Check for Win32. If so, define USE_INSTALLED_GLIB,
	and don't configure in the included glib-1.2.8. Set GLIB_CFLAGS
	and GLIB_LIBS assuming that GLib is installed in the same location
	pkgconfig will be. Check for dirent.h, unistd.h and sys/wait.h
	headers.

	* Makefile.am: If USE_INSTALLED_GLIB, use the GLIB_* values set
	above, and don't make in the glib-1.2.8 subdir.

	* autogen.sh: Use perl -p -i.bak, works better on Win32 (and Cygwin).

	* *.c: Conditionalize inclusions of unistd.h and sys/wait.h.

	* findme.c: Define X_OK on Win32 if necessary.

	* parse.c
	* popthelp.c: Minor Win32 portability ifdefs.

	* parse.c: No need to include <windows.h>.

	* pkg.c: Don't hardcode PKGLIBDIR, but use
	g_win32_get_package_installation_directory() to deduce it.
	(scan_dir): Make a temp copy of dirname with potential superfluous
	trailing slash removed. The Win32 opendir implementation doesn't
	always like those.

	* pkg.h: If USE_INSTALLED_GLIB, include <glib.h> instead of
	partial-glib.h.

	* popt.c (execCommand): Don't compile on Win32.

	* poptconfig.c (configLine): Don't bother with the "exec" stuff on
	Win32, too complex to port, at least for now.
	(poptReadDefaultConfig) Don't bother compiling on Win32, this
	function isn't even called.
